Longville, Minnesota Climate Data

Longville, Minnesota has a Humid Continental Mild Summer, Wet All Year climate (Köppen classification: Dfb). Average annual temperatures range from 29.7 °F (low) to 50.2 °F (high). Annual precipitation averages 27.5 Inches. Longville is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 3b.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around May 1 - May 10 through the first frost around Sep. 21 - Sep. 30.
